Philip Hocking

  • Born: 1841, Redruth, Cornwall, England
  • Marriage (1): Mary Ann Julian on 9 Jun 1859 in the Bride's father's House, Kooringa, South Australia, Australia
  • Died: 10 Feb 1867, Kapunda, , South Australia, Australia at age 26
  • Buried: Feb 1867, Burra Cemetery, Burra, South Australia, Australia

bullet  General Notes:

His parents, William and Sarah emigrated to South Australia on the Storm Cloud an iron ship of 907 tons, under the command of Capt. James Campbell. They departed Plymouth on the 12th February 1858 and arrived at Port Adelaide on the 28th April 1858. William was 47 years old and a Miner. Sarah was 49. Their young son, Richard, travelled with them, he was 14 years old. Also on board were their other sons, John and his family, and Samuel and his family; Frederick aged 15 and a Miner; Philip aged 17 and a Miner; and Stephen, aged 19 and a Miner. A grandchild, William Henry Hocking was born on board on the 30th April 1858 to their son John and his wife Elizabeth.

He is buried next to his father in the Burra Cemetery.

Philip married Mary Ann Julian, daughter of Hannibal Julian and Unknown, on 9 Jun 1859 in the Bride's father's House, Kooringa, South Australia, Australia. (Mary Ann Julian was born in 1842 and died on 27 May 1891.)
